"description": "The University of Florida Herbarium (FLAS) in the Florida Museum of Natural\n History contains approximately 500,000 specimens of vascular plants, \nbryophytes, lichens, fungi, and wood, with the earliest specimens dating\n to the early to mid-1800s. The FLAS acronym is the standard \ninternational abbreviation for the Herbarium, derived from its early \nassociation with the Florida Agricultural Experiment Station. The \nherbarium was established in 1891 by Peter H. Rolfs of Florida \nAgricultural College in Lake City, and later moved to the University of \nFlorida in Gainesville in 1906. The vascular plant collection (ca. \n320,000 specimens) has an excellent representation of the USA (esp. \nFlorida and the southeastern USA), the West Indies (esp. Hispaniola), \nand other Neotropical areas. The bryophyte collection (ca. 70,000 \nspecimens) and lichen collection (ca. 16,000 specimens) are worldwide in\n scope (esp. Florida and Neotropical areas such as Costa Rica, \nVenezuela, and Brazil). The wood collection (ca. 16,000 specimens) is \nworldwide in scope (esp. tropical woods). The algal collection includes \nca. 3,500 specimens, mainly from Florida. The Fungal Herbarium contains \nca. 55,000 specimens (primarily non-lichenized fungi and slime molds). \nThis digital dataset serves the vascular plant collection, of which ca. \n2/3 are digitized, including ca. 500 type specimens (holo-, lecto-, \niso-, neo-, or epi-types). The herbarium's digitization effort has been \nsupported by several institutions, including the Florida Museum of \nNatural History, Institute of Food and Agricultural Sciences, National \nScience Foundation, United States Department of Agriculture (Hatch \nProject FLAS-HRB-04170), UF Libraries Digital Library Center, Florida \nCenter for Library Automation, Florida Museum Associates, and the Andrew\n W. Mellon Foundation.",
